Denia is the 5-star Fusion Rectifier introduced in Wuthering Waves 3.3, built around switching between Stagecraft Form and Breakdown Form to enable Fusion Burst and Tune Strain teams. She works primarily as a Resonance Liberation sub-DPS and amplifier, leaning on her Forte Circuit for resource generation and her Final Act skills for burst damage.

How Denia works in combat
Denia toggles between two stances that feed each other. Stagecraft Form generates Void Particles through basic attacks, and casting Final Act – Stagecraft Form pushes her into Breakdown Form with Entropy Shift: Breakdown Form active, which trickles Void Particles back over time.
Breakdown Form converts Void Particles into Conformal Charge. With Dark Cores on hand, her Resonance Skill upgrades from Beckon to Banish – Breakdown Form Stage 2, and every Dark Core consumed adds 150% to that hit's damage multiplier. When Conformal Charge fills, Final Act – Breakdown Form fires off as her main nuke, leaves an Erosion Field that pulls enemies and ticks for Resonance Liberation damage for 30 seconds, then drops her back to Stagecraft Form with a 30% ATK buff from Entropy Shift: Stagecraft Form.
Her inherent skill refunds Dark Cores up to 2 and Void Particles up to 20 at the start of combat, so the opening rotation is always loaded.
The other lever is her Resonance Mode. Fusion Burst mode applies Fusion Burst stacks and grants the whole team 30% Fusion DMG Bonus while she sits in an Entropy Shift state. Tune Strain mode applies Tune Strain – Shifting, refreshes Tune Strain – Interfered, and hands the team 45 Break Boost instead.

Skill priority
Denia's damage spreads across Resonance Liberation, Forte Circuit, and Resonance Skill, with Liberation acting as both her form-switch button and her highest multiplier.
| Priority | Skill | Why |
|---|---|---|
| 1 | Resonance Liberation | Controls form switching and carries Final Act damage. |
| 2 | Forte Circuit | Powers Void Particle, Conformal Charge, and the Erosion Field. |
| 3 | Resonance Skill | Banish – Breakdown Form scales hard with Dark Cores. |
| 4 | Basic Attack | Used for resource generation; low direct damage. |
| 5 | Intro Skill | Minor contribution; level last. |
Unlock both inherent skills as soon as the materials allow. The first refills resources at combat start, and the second is what grants the team the 30% Fusion DMG Bonus or 45 Break Boost during Entropy Shift windows.
Rotation
Step 1: Open in Stagecraft Form and chain basic attacks to top off Void Particles. The inherent skill already starts you with Dark Cores and 20 Void Particles, so this is short.

Step 2: Cast Final Act – Stagecraft Form to flip into Breakdown Form. You now have Entropy Shift: Breakdown Form ticking Void Particles back, and your Resonance Mode buff applied to the team.
Step 3: Spend Dark Cores on Banish – Breakdown Form Stage 2. Try to consume all 3 Dark Cores in one cast for the maximum 450% multiplier add-on, which counts as Resonance Liberation DMG.
Step 4: Use basic attacks in Breakdown Form to convert Void Particles into Conformal Charge. Normal attacks here count as Resonance Liberation DMG and get a 50% multiplier bonus while Void Particle is held.
Step 5: Once Conformal Charge is full, fire Final Act – Breakdown Form for the main burst. This deploys the Erosion Field for 30 seconds of off-field Resonance Liberation damage and returns her to Stagecraft Form with a 30% ATK buff for the next cycle.
Step 6: Swap to your main DPS through Outro Skill. The incoming Resonator gets the echo set's outgoing buff (Fusion DMG Bonus from Chromatic Foam or ATK from Reel of Spliced Memories) while the Erosion Field continues to tick in the background.

Best weapons
Denia wants ATK, Crit, and Resonance Liberation DMG Bonus. Effects that trigger from Fusion Burst or Tune Strain – Shifting line up with both of her Resonance Modes.
| Weapon | Rarity | Notes |
|---|---|---|
| Forged Dwarf Star | 5★ | Signature. 500 ATK, 36% Crit Rate. +12% ATK, +36% Resonance Liberation DMG for 5s on Fusion Burst or Tune Strain – Shifting; teammates also gain +24% ATK for 15s when they apply the same statuses. |
| Stringmaster | 5★ | Best F2P-friendly 5★ swap. Strong for off-field damage and can edge out the signature in off-field-heavy setups. |
| Lethean Elegy | 5★ | 587 ATK with 24.3% Crit Rate; works as a generic high-stat stick if you have it built. |
| Cosmic Ripples | 5★ | Energy Regen + ATK substat; usable when energy is tight. |
| Augment | 4★ | Battle Pass option. Crit Rate substat and an ATK buff tied to Resonance Liberation casts. |
| Variation | 4★ | Niche; sacrifices personal damage for faster Concerto cycling. |
| Waltz in Masquerade | 4★ | Stacking ATK against debuffed enemies, which Denia applies constantly. |
Forged Dwarf Star is the strongest because the team-wide ATK buff stacks cleanly on top of her Fusion DMG Bonus from inherent skill 2. Stringmaster is the cleanest pull-free option if you already have Yinlin's signature.
Best echo sets
The right set depends on which Resonance Mode you lock in before the fight and who the main DPS is.
| Set | When to use | Key effect |
|---|---|---|
| Chromatic Foam | Fusion Burst teams (e.g., Aemeath as main DPS) | 2pc: +10% Fusion DMG. 5pc: Inflicting Fusion Burst grants +10% Fusion DMG, and casting Outro Skill during it passes +25% Fusion DMG to the incoming Resonator for 15s. |
| Reel of Spliced Memories | Tune Strain teams | 2pc: +10% ATK. 5pc: Applying Tune Strain – Shifting grants the team +20 Tune Break Boost for 30s. |
| Flaming Clawprint | Tune, DoT, or Denia-as-main-DPS | 2pc: +10% Fusion DMG. 5pc: Resonance Liberation grants the team +15% Fusion DMG and Denia +20% Resonance Liberation DMG for 35s. |
| Moonlit Clouds | Universal fallback | 2pc: +10% Energy Regen. 5pc: Outro Skill grants the next Resonator +22.5% ATK for 15s. |
The 4-cost main echo follows the set. Trickster (Chromatic Foam) deals 273.6% Fusion DMG and carries a +12% Fusion DMG handoff. Voidwing Moth (Reel of Spliced Memories) tap-deals 405% Spectro DMG with a +12% ATK handoff. Lioness of Glory adds 12% Fusion DMG and 12% Resonance Liberation DMG to the equipped Resonator directly. Impermanence Heron remains a safe pick if you only have Moonlit Clouds available.

Echo stats
Cost layout is 4-3-3-1-1. Crit is the bottleneck because Denia's Forte Circuit, Liberation, and Erosion Field all crit independently.
| Slot | Main stat |
|---|---|
| Cost 4 | Crit DMG or Crit Rate |
| Cost 3 | Fusion DMG Bonus or ATK% |
| Cost 3 | Fusion DMG Bonus or ATK% |
| Cost 1 | ATK% |
| Cost 1 | ATK% |
For substats, prioritize Energy Regen until around 125%, then move to Crit DMG and Crit Rate, then ATK%, then Resonance Liberation DMG Bonus. Flat ATK is the lowest-value roll. Because her inherent skill refills resources at combat start, you do not need to push Energy Regen far past the 125% threshold.
Best team comps
Denia slots cleanly into Fusion Burst and Tune Strain cores. The strongest current pairing keeps Aemeath as the on-field Fusion DPS while Chisa handles healing and debuff support.
| Team | Main DPS | Sub-DPS / Amp | Support | Resonance Mode |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Fusion Burst | Aemeath | Denia | Chisa | Fusion Burst |
| Tune Strain | Luuk Herssen | Denia | Chisa or Shorekeeper | Tune Strain |
| Fusion DoT | Changli or Brant | Denia | Verina / Baizhi | Fusion Burst |
In Fusion Burst comps, set Denia to Resonance Mode – Fusion Burst before combat so her inherent buff broadcasts +30% Fusion DMG Bonus and the Erosion Field counts toward Fusion Burst kills. For Tune Strain comps, swap modes so her hits apply Tune Strain – Shifting and her inherent skill swaps to +45 Break Boost for the team.

Resonance chain priority
Denia functions well at S0R1. Her chain ordering is built around small but meaningful damage, and quality-of-life adds rather than mechanic rewrites.
S1 grants 30% Crit DMG and interruption immunity while casting Phantom Bubble or Banish, and reclassifies their damage as Resonance Liberation DMG, which lets the damage benefit from Liberation buffs and her signature weapon's Liberation DMG line. Higher chains (S2, S3, and S6) continue to scale her numbers, with S6 being the practical ceiling for whales.
Recommended pull priority is S0R1 first, then S2R1, then S3R1, then push to S6R1 or S6R5 only if you intend to invest fully.
